Key Considerations for Choosing a Laptop
Processing Power: A powerful
processor, preferably Intel Core i5 or i7, is crucial for handling
resource-intensive tasks and running virtual machines.
Memory (RAM): Aim for a minimum
of 8GB RAM, which provides smooth multitasking and efficient performance.
Storage: Opt for a laptop with
SSD (Solid State Drive) storage, as it offers faster data access and quicker
boot times.
Graphics Card: While a dedicated
graphics card is not mandatory for all computer science tasks, it can be beneficial
for tasks such as video editing or 3D modeling.
Screen Size and Resolution: A 14
to 15.6-inch display with Full HD resolution is recommended for comfortable
coding and content consumption.
Battery Life: Look for a laptop
with long battery life, ideally lasting 8 hours or more, to support extended
study sessions or coding marathons.
Connectivity and Ports: Ensure
the laptop has a sufficient number of USB ports, HDMI, and an SD card reader to
connect peripherals and external devices.

Operating System Options
The recommended laptop models are available with various operating system options to cater to different preferences and requirements:
Windows: Most laptops come pre-installed with the Windows operating system, which offers a wide range of software compatibility and a familiar user interface. Windows laptops are highly versatile and compatible with numerous programming languages and development environments.
macOS: Apple laptops, such as the MacBook Pro, come with the macOS operating system. macOS provides a seamless and intuitive user experience, favored by many computer science professionals. It offers built-in development tools and is known for its stability and security.
Linux: Linux is a popular choice among computer science enthusiasts and programmers. It provides a highly customizable and open-source environment, allowing students to experiment with different software configurations. Laptops compatible with Linux offer great flexibility and are well-suited for coding and development purposes.

Additional Features and Accessories
While the core specifications and performance are crucial, there are a few additional features and accessories that can enhance the overall user experience for computer science students:
Backlit Keyboard: A backlit keyboard allows students to work comfortably in low-light environments, such as libraries or late-night study sessions.
Fingerprint Sensor: Laptops equipped with a fingerprint sensor provide an added layer of security and convenience for quick login.
USB Type-C and Thunderbolt 3 Ports: These ports offer fast data transfer speeds and support for external displays, making them useful for connecting additional monitors or peripherals.
External Monitor: Investing in an external monitor can significantly improve productivity, as it provides a larger workspace for coding and multitasking.

Frequently Asked Questions (FAQs)
Q: Can I use a budget laptop for computer science studies?
A: While a
budget laptop can be sufficient for basic programming tasks, it is recommended
to invest in a laptop with higher specifications to handle resource-intensive
software and coding projects effectively.
Q: Is a dedicated graphics card necessary for computer science students?
A: A
dedicated graphics card is not essential for most computer science tasks.
However, if you plan to work on graphics-intensive projects or gaming, a
dedicated graphics card can provide better performance.
Q: Can I upgrade the RAM and storage of my laptop later?
A: It
depends on the laptop model. Some laptops allow for easy upgrades, while others
have soldered components that cannot be upgraded. Check the specifications and
user reviews of the laptop before making a purchase.
Q: Is it better to choose a Windows, macOS, or Linux laptop for computer science studies?
A: The choice of operating system
depends on personal preference and specific requirements. Windows is widely
used and compatible with various software. macOS offers a seamless user
experience and is favored by developers. Linux provides customization and
flexibility, ideal for enthusiasts and those interested in open-source
development.
Q: Are touchscreen laptops beneficial for computer science students?
A:
Touchscreen laptops can be beneficial depending on individual preferences and
the specific tasks a student performs. While not essential, touchscreen
functionality can make certain tasks more intuitive, such as zooming in on code
or interacting with touch-enabled software. However, it's important to note
that most programming tasks are still optimized for traditional keyboard and
mouse input.
Q: What should I consider when choosing a laptop for computer science studies in India?
A: Apart from the technical specifications mentioned earlier, it's important to consider factors such as warranty and after-sales support provided by the manufacturer. Additionally, check for the availability of authorized service centers in your location for convenient repairs and maintenance.
Q: Can I use a gaming laptop for computer
science studies?
A: Gaming
laptops often come with powerful processors and graphics cards, which can be
beneficial for handling resource-intensive tasks in computer science. However,
they may be bulkier and heavier, which could impact portability. Additionally,
gaming laptops may have shorter battery life compared to laptops specifically
designed for productivity and programming.
Q: Are there any student discounts available
for purchasing laptops in India?
A: Yes,
many laptop manufacturers and retailers offer student discounts or special
pricing for educational institutions. It's recommended to check with the
manufacturer's website or authorized resellers to explore available discounts
or promotions.

Q: How long can a laptop for computer science studies last?
A: The
lifespan of a laptop depends on several factors, including the quality of
components, usage patterns, and maintenance. On average, a well-maintained
laptop can last for 4-5 years or even longer with regular updates and proper
care.
